Output 84ab320ec84c233e69367e339e08ad50dfdc21e8dcc98f1b6d30fe5f8bea3b38:2

value
23038
script pubkey
OP_HASH160 OP_PUSHBYTES_20 722fcc81635e708e1365955435601c71ca5bbc61 OP_EQUAL
address
3C6nDXxy13h7iikvX5XPwDVUXYW7pvEujJ
transaction
84ab320ec84c233e69367e339e08ad50dfdc21e8dcc98f1b6d30fe5f8bea3b38
spent
true